Transaction 91d4936bc158d6e61f4eefac68f311313771fdf584bbca1da180035f9883ef0a
1 Input
1 Output
-
91d4936bc158d6e61f4eefac68f311313771fdf584bbca1da180035f9883ef0a:0
- value
- 1717142641
- script pubkey
- OP_0 OP_PUSHBYTES_20 e14ad8b3b373763c5bd09fe4a259bf8b6cafd1f5
- address
- ltc1qu99d3vanwdmrck7snlj2ykdl3dk2l504phj6px